(CSE: MEDA) (OTC: MEDAF) (FWB: 1ZY) (“Medaro” or the “Company”), a multi-faceted venture aimed at developing innovative spodumene processing technology concurrent with its lithium focused exploration in Canada, is pleased to provide and update on its Double Closed-Loop Chemical Process for Recovering Lithium, Aluminum and Silica from a Calcined Spodumene Concentrate, and our 2022 exploration program. The development of our technology process for Lithium extraction from Spodumene continues to evolve at a rapid pace. Most of the testing has been completed and we are now focusing on the optimization and refining process. While our attorneys are working on the application for our Provisional Patent, we have engaged multiple third-party laboratories to validate our findings. The 2022 Field program is well underway and Medaro would like to provide an update as to what has been accomplished, and what will be happening over the next few months; Yurchison Lake Northern Saskatchewan – Uranium The exploration work at Yurchison is a two-phase program, where Phase one has been successfully completed on the 15th of July, which included a re-assessment of historical exploration data. Also, a six-person crew completed ground prospecting, mapping, and sampling work to confirm historical mineralization areas and their extensions, as well as sampling new zones and areas of interest with the aid of handheld Scintillometers and Spectrometers. To date 585 soil and rock samples have been collected for laboratory analysis with results expected in four to six weeks. Phase two of the program is contracted to begin August 5th. This Phase will be an airborne magnetic, very low frequency (VLF) electromagnetic geophysical and radiometric survey to help generate targets for further exploration, and diamond drilling, which is scheduled to last about four weeks. Superb Lake Thunder Bay, Ontario – Lithium The field program at Superb Lake has been organized for the 2022 season. A four-person crew spent three weeks prospecting, mapping, and sampling the property, where 161 samples were taken and have been sent to the laboratory for analysis, results are expected in four to six weeks.
